California Deaths By County in 2021

Updated on June 16, 2025.

According to the US Census Bureau estimates, in 2021, the number of deaths for California was 345,285. Los Angeles had the highest number of deaths (88,940), followed by San Diego (26,912), and Orange (26,401). On the other hand, Alpine had the lowest number of deaths (27), followed by Sierra (36), and Mono (50).
